Essence of conception «Mobility-as-a-Service» (MaaS) is to place an user in the center of transport services and offer to him the personalized method of movement taking into account individual necessities. MaaS integrates the various methods of movement the different types of transport in single service that is accessible on demand. Service comes true through a single account with monthly payment. One of the main conditions for the successful operation of MaaS is the ability of smartphones to access different modes of transport. For the first time, the MaaS concept was implemented in the Swedish city of Gothenburg, offering excellent public transport conditions and sustainable urban mobility. The aim of a transport politics is support of a transport system that provides the movement of passengers and commodities. MaaS is examined as an increase of comfort of journeys and development of the system of safe and reliable transport. The most famous MaaS system was due to Helsinki, where they were able to offer a convenient and competitive platform. Since public transport is the core of the MaaS system, the city must offer quality public transport services so that users can easily move around the city without having their own car.
The following conditions are required for the implementation of the MaaS system: different types of urban public transport; most transport operators open their data, including real-time data, to third parties; most transport operators allow third parties to sell their services; most transport operators support an electronic payment system to access their services. In the article we examine relevant problems regarding human rights on roads with arising digitalized processes. The problems cover three aspects. First, are the rights of drivers, passengers, and impaired individuals who use digitalized management systems while on the roads. Second, is the protection of the rights of those who are dismissed from driving the public transport with digitalized management systems. Third, is the potential danger to the society from economic outcomes of further digitalization. In the end, the article gives a comprehensive argument about the importance of securing human rights on the roads as it was brought up to our attention by the United Nations.
Following the afore mentioned aspects of the problem, the article derives hypothetical solutions regarding human rights of road users with arising digitalized process. First of all, it remains essential to reinforce drivers’ rules on the roads. Next, safety of pedestrians, people who are travelling on foot, needs to be ensured since they are worse off in case of an emergency on the roads. Finally, it is a special focus on ensuring the rights of persons with disabilities. The latter applies not only to the drivers and pedestrians, but also to passengers with disabilities who use the means of urban ground transportation.

Blockchain technology takes its origin in the emergence of cryptocurrency-bitcoin, which serves as an alternative payment system, which in turn, unlike traditional payment systems is not controlled by any state or banks. A distinctive feature of this system is that
the addition and storage of data is carried out within the network of nodes, and takes the form of a linear chain, there is no need to involve a Central Supervisory authority in such conditions. Only network users can add new transactions. Thus, for the digital
economy, the blockchain system is a distributed database consisting of separate blocks taking the form of an unbroken chain that stores both all the transactions that took place and all the data of wallets that once existed.it is an “eternal digital magazine” that
can be programmed to register almost anything that represents a certain value. This explains the fact that not only cryptocurrency fnds its application in the blockchain system. Each cell of the blockchain includes a timestamp and a link to the previous block.
Because of what it can be virtually infnite, but in real life the possibilities of technology limit it.
